eBay Being Sued Again in China

October 19, 2006 by Ty | 0 Comments

eBay’s Chinese portal was in court again yesterday, accused of selling pirated digital books.

The company’s Chinese partner Eachnet Trading Company Ltd stands accused of infringing intellectual property rights. The case opened at Shanghai No 2 Intermediate People’s Court.

Hong Kong-based Digital Heritage Publishing Ltd and Shanghai People’s Publishing House are suing eBay for selling their products on the auction web site without authorization.

They also claim the copies which eBay sold were pirated.
